Key elements affecting costs.
Upgrading a kitchen in Troy, TX, involves various factors that influence the overall project cost. Understanding typical options can help homeowners plan effectively and compare different choices for materials, scope, and complexity.
- Materials: Choices range from standard laminate countertops and basic cabinetry to high-end granite or quartz surfaces and custom wood cabinets.
- Size and Scope: Projects may include partial upgrades, such as replacing appliances and countertops, or full renovations involving layout changes and new flooring.
- Labor Complexity: Simpler upgrades like installing new fixtures require less labor, while extensive remodels with electrical, plumbing, and structural work are more involved.
- Permitting: Some upgrades may require permits from local authorities, especially if structural modifications or electrical and plumbing work are involved.
- Extras: Additional features such as custom backsplashes, under-cabinet lighting, or smart home integrations can increase overall project costs.
